Alright, folks, gather 'round because Coconutdaddy is serving up another cult classic on Tuesday Night Movie Night! This week, we dive headfirst into the wonderfully twisted world of Roger Corman’s A Bucket of Blood (1959) – a film where art, murder, and beatnik poetry collide in the most hilariously disturbing way possible. 🎭☕💀 So, What’s the Deal? Meet Walter Paisley , a bumbling busboy with dreams of becoming the next big thing in the artsy beatnik scene. His method? Oh, just a little something called murder —with a side of plaster. When Walter accidentally kills a cat (yes, accidentally ), he covers it in clay and suddenly becomes the toast of the underground art world.
